Ahmad Shahidov gave an interview to CGTN: President Ilham Aliyev’s visit to China and regional projects discussed


The official visit of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ev to China has played a significant role in strengthening the strategic partnership between the two countries. During the visit, important agreements were reached to further expand cooperation between Azerbaijan and China in the fields of politics, economy, transport, and culture. Discussions were also held on regional and global projects, particularly the “Belt and Road” initiative and the future of the Zangezur Corridor.

On this occasion, Ahmad Shahidov, Chairman of the Azerbaijan Institute for Democracy and Human Rights and a well-known human rights defender, gave an extensive interview to China’s prominent international television channel CGTN. In the interview, he shared his views on President Ilham Aliyev’s visit to China, the developing cooperation between the two countries, the “Belt and Road” project, the regional implications of the Zangezur Corridor, and security matters.

Ahmad Shahidov emphasized that the political, economic, and cultural relations between Azerbaijan and China have been dynamically developing in recent years. He noted that President Ilham Aliyev’s visit to China marked an important milestone in further deepening these ties and elevating them to the level of a strategic partnership.

Speaking about the “Belt and Road” initiative, Ahmad Shahidov highlighted Azerbaijan’s growing role as a regional transit and logistics hub. He stated that thanks to the country’s geographical location and investments in its transportation infrastructure, Azerbaijan has become one of the key partners in this global project.

Ahmad Shahidov also spoke about the positive impact that the opening of the Zangezur Corridor would have on regional economic cooperation and peace. He stressed that this corridor would create new transportation opportunities not only for Azerbaijan but also for China, Central Asian, and European countries, contributing to stability in the region.

In conclusion, Ahmad Shahidov noted that humanitarian and cultural ties between Azerbaijan and China are also strengthening and expressed his confidence that mutual trust-based relations would continue to grow in the future.

The interview, broadcast via CGTN, was met with interest by an international audience and delivered important messages about the future of Azerbaijan-China relations.
